Mesothelioma

Mesothelioma is a malignant (cancer) condition that affects the tissues of the chest cavity as well as lungs. It can also form in the peritoneum (the thin layer of tissue that lines the abdomen). It is caused by exposure to asbestos, a class of fibers that was once employed as insulation and fire-retardant substances. Cancer typically takes 15 years or more to be diagnosed and can affect anyone.

Asbestos trust funds are the financial resources available to asbestos victims. Asbestos manufacturers set trusts to protect asbestos victims as part of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ection, which protects them from lawsuits, but requires them to contribute to the trust. The trustee oversees the trust and decides the amount that is given to victims. Individuals may be able claim compensation from more than one asbestos trust fund.

The time frame for a trust-fund payout could vary from case-to-case. A mesothelioma lawyer with experience can help you file for an expedited review, which ensures your claim is processed quicker. An expedited review typically offers a fixed payout amount based on the type of asbestos-related disease diagnosed. Your attorney can also request an individual review. This will take a closer analysis of your case and assigns your diagnosis a unique value.

Individual reviews tend to be longer than expedited reviews but permit more attention to the unique circumstances of your case. This includes your work history as well as the kind of asbestos you were exposed to, which may result in a greater amount of compensation than the predetermined amounts that are offered in the expedited review process.
